Depends on ambient temperature where your incubator is. If the core temperature of the eggs didn't drop below 96, you're probably ok. If the incubator is outside and the ambient temperature was cold, then the core temperature of those eggs probably dropped below 96. If the incubator is inside your house, or in an insulated, heated building, then you could be fine.
